Do Dogs Feel the Cold in Cold Weather? - Cold Dogs in Winter

WebFeb 18, 2024 · Cold Weather . Many dogs with thin coats or low-fat content, like greyhounds and Dobermans, get cold easily. Even if it’s 50 or 60 degrees F outside, some dogs get chilly. In certain cases, the cold can be quite harmful for our pets. On the one hand, due to low temperatures, dogs can develop respiratory diseases such as tracheobronchitis, pharyngitis, bronchitis, or even pneumonia.
